Hydrophobic coating

Hydrophobic coatings can make it easier to remove dirt and spots from surfaces like metal, glass, and plastic. They can also protect surfaces from damage caused by moisture and improve their durability. They are commonly used on outdoor surfaces, and they can reduce the time needed to clean and the cost. They can also aid in preventing rust and corrosion, and they may even provide UV protection.

Unlike regular paint hydrophobic coatings have a smooth surface that blocks water molecules. These coatings are usually made from fluoropolymers, including polytetrafluoroethylene (PTFE), better known as Teflon. These materials have high lubricity and a slippery feel. They can be applied to glass, metals, and textiles. Manufacturers measure the hydrophobicity of a material by placing the droplet of water onto the surface and determining its contact angle. Coatings with a contact angle of 150 degrees or more are considered super-hydrophobic.

Windows that are safe

While the majority of the security industry is focused on doors and locks, burglars are also able to gain access through windows. Two of three burglaries in America involve windows.

There are many ways to make your home's windows more secure. Installing window air leakage repair bars will help to stop burglars from entering your home through windows. They come in a variety of styles. They also give you a sense of privacy without compromising your view.

Another option is to install glass that is tempered. It is more durable and secure than regular annealed glasses. When tempered glass breaks it, it breaks into tiny, harmless fragments, rather than sharp, dangerous shards. This kind of glass also helps to reduce the likelihood of injuries from broken windows, especially during an event of natural disaster or break-in.

Complete window maintenance replacement

You can boost the energy efficiency of your home as well as its curb appeal by replacing all your windows. You can upgrade your windows to better quality ones with insulated glass and modern casement window crank repair films. These techniques reduce energy losses and transfers and lower your cooling and heating costs. They are also easier to maintain and clean. You can pick from a variety of color options and features that can enhance the appearance of your new windows.

Full frame window replacement is more expensive than insert replacement, but it's usually worth the cost. The process includes removing exterior and interior trim as well as the installation of the new window. This allows for thorough inspections and repairs which will reduce the amount of moisture that might have built up over time in the window that was previously installed.

The cost of a new window is contingent on the size and type you choose and the location of your home. It is recommended to get several estimates before choosing a firm to replace your windows. You should also verify the insurance and license status of the company.

You will find this information on the company's website or contact them for more information. You can also get referrals from previous customers. If you're looking to replace windows in a older home You should also search for companies that have worked with lead paint. The Environmental Protection Agency offers a database of certified "lead-safe" contractors and can be found on the internet. You'll be satisfied with your new windows if choose the right company.
